About the role:
About the role exciting opportunities have arisen for the appointment of two full time Finance Officers , one permanent and one 6-months Fixed-Term contract within the Financial Control section whose responsibilities include the operational running of the Council’s main financial system, Systems Applications Programming (SAP - vendors, customers, users, chart of accounts); managing the Council’s Sundry Debt portfolio; managing Corporate Refunds and Write-off processing. This involves the provision of expert advice, guidance and support to both new and existing users and business units and, ensuring audit compliance in our processes.
